Zoning Laws and Regulations: Zoning laws are the cornerstone of urban planning, dictating how land and properties can be used within specific areas. They influence property development, occupancy, and overall community development. In the realm of real estate, two key professions often intersect: leasing agents and real estate agents. While both roles involve facilitating transactions within the housing market, they have distinct responsibilities, qualifications, and compensation structures. Understanding the disparities between leasing agents and real estate agents is crucial for those considering a career in real estate or seeking services within the industry. What is Leasing Agent? Leasing agents primarily focus on facilitating the rental process for residential vs commercial properties. Their responsibilities include marketing available properties, screening potential tenants, conducting property viewings, and negotiating lease agreements. They act as intermediaries between landlords and tenants, ensuring smooth transactions and addressing any concerns that may arise during the leasing process. What is Real Estate Agent? Types of Commission Structures Fixed Percentage Commission: In this model, leasing agents earn a predetermined percentage of the total lease value. For instance, if the commission rate is set at 5% and the annual rent for a property is $20,000, the leasing agent would earn $1,000.
